Is there a service feature I can set the idle speed? Or something if I want to do a service on something. Example I want to clean the throttlebody or increase the idle speed a bit while I pour in some Seafoam or something is there a way to do that with ForScan and not have to get a buddy helper to give it gas?
The Throttle Body itself is better cleaned by removal, however, do NOT force or move the Throttle Plate by force, especially if still hooked up in the Truck. That Throttle Plate is gear driven & thus can crush your fingers easily. If you force it while removed from the engine, it can knock it out of its home position & will have to be re-calibrated. Ford Tech Makuloco, has stated this in one of his Video's.
With that being said, Seafoam cleans so much more inside the Intake & Upper Cylinder's. I remove the Throttle Body to thoroughly clean, then spray a can through the TB as suggested to clean inside the upper engine. Don't forget the bottle in your fuel tank too.
